Hi.

 

I have the above TV and have been using this with a Humax YouView PVR however the Humax has now died. 

Looking at the alternatives I've decided to go with an external USB HDD and use the recording function of the TV. 

With my Humax PVR I could pause and rewind live TV by default. I believe the buffer was 2 hours however using the Samsung built in timeshift it appears that I have to manually activate it in order to have this facility?

So for example if I turn on the TV I cant rewind live TV unless I've already activated the timeshift and if I was to switch channel I would have to start the timeshift again to have that function. Is that correct? Is there any way to have the timeshift automatically enabled?

I'm experimenting as I write and I have 2 simultaneous recordings going whilst watching another channel so happy with that however it appears I cant use timeshift with 2 other channel recordings going.

When I stop one of the recordings I can then use the timeshift.

 

So I'm essentially happy with what I've got now however losing the automatic ability to rewind something I'm watching is a big miss.

Having to now manually start the timeshift every time is far from ideal and I'll probably only remember when it's too late.

 

If there is a way to automatically start the timeshift then that's the solution.
